The Straight Cut completely alters the psychological weight of the film. Instead of progressing from horror to heartbreak, the chronological version builds linearly toward an inevitable, devastating climax. Interestingly, the new cut runs approximately seven minutes shorter than the original, trimming structural transitions while adding a bleak, cyclical finality. The famous concluding thesis statement is also completely subverted, changing from "Time destroys everything" to "Le temps révèle tout" (Time reveals all). Critics note that viewing both versions in tandem creates a highly unique, multi-angled cinematic experiment.

Irréversible tells the story of a tragic night in Paris through a series of roughly thirteen long, uninterrupted takes 1.2.3 . The story is told in reverse order, starting with the devastating aftermath of a violent crime and moving backward to the innocent, peaceful moments that preceded it.
